Luke Brett

Luke Brett graduated from the University of Tasmania in 2011 and was admitted to practice in 2012. Luke began his career in private practice before working at Tasmania Legal Aid, specialising in criminal law. Luke commenced work at the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ions (DPP) in 2014, where he reached the role of Principal Crown Counsel, specialising in sexual assault and family violence cases. Luke left the DPP in 2025, commencing in private practice as a Hobart based sole practitioner, specialising in criminal law practice. Over the course of his career, he has acted as counsel in numerous criminal trials, sentencing hearings and appeals.
